WebLet’s break down some energy cost estimates for a better understanding: A 1500-watt baseboard heater or space heater uses 1.5 kWh of electricity per hour of usage. If the cost of electricity is $0.13 per kWh, then each hour of heater usage costs around $0.20. Using the heater for 4 hours a day could result in a monthly cost of approximately $24. WebJan 8, 2024 · Baseboard heaters can supply heat to individual rooms so they work well for zone heating. By heating only the occupied rooms, you can leave guest rooms or unused bedrooms cooler. This can produce energy savings up to 20% versus heating your entire home. You can also save money by running your baseboard heaters constantly. WebReceptacles are prohibited above electric baseboard heat in the usa primarily because any cords hanging above the heaters can be subject to melting, insulation damage, exposed conductors, hazard, etc. It would fail inspection here and either the outlets or the heaters would need to be moved.
